**Announcement**

With heavy hearts, we are saddened to announce that Char19 will not reopen at the previous location, following a kitchen fire that unexpectedly shuttered the restaurant in March.

We have thought and prayed over this decision for months. First and foremost was our concern for our guests, who were so supportive of our efforts to grow a local restaurant, who allowed us to be part of their special memories, and who made this endeavor truly worthwhile. As a small business, we also considered the impact closing would have on our employees, who grew along with us and became our family. Reaching the decision to close under these circumstances was not easy.

Ultimately, though, our desire to continue to serve our guests succumbed to reality. Although the fire was largely confined to a small area, smoke damage impacted the entire restaurant, requiring an extensive rebuild. The possibility of being closed for several more months while contractors work, the uncertainty of basically starting over after being closed for so long, and the loss of income weighed heavily in favor of our decision.

We are keeping the Char19 brand alive and are currently in the process of opening Pour, a specialty wine and cocktail bar, in North Monroe. Gift cards that were purchased through Char can be redeemed at our new establishment. We hope that many of you who stopped in for a drink or a bite to eat at Char 19 will visit us for the same great service and atmosphere. Please visit us on our page at Pour by Char 19.
